Former President Barack Obama has endorsed Kamala Harris for the White House, saying that he and Michelle will do “everything we can” to see her elected into office.
Obama said Harris would make a “fantastic President” and that she has his “full support”.
He and his wife, Michelle Obama, shared a video officially endorsing Harris over the phone.
It comes after the 44th president released a statement when President Biden dropped out, suggesting he favoured a more rigorous selection process.
“I have extraordinary confidence that the leaders of our party will be able to create a process from which an outstanding nominee emerges,” the statement said.
